Transaction 500c76f8260cbb55265ae0e9b160ca1d3affef5c0c592c68758203016088e070
1 Input
1 Output
-
500c76f8260cbb55265ae0e9b160ca1d3affef5c0c592c68758203016088e070:0
- value
- 108103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69eea91d37a4c146475d2a375c45fa30039910ae OP_EQUAL
- address
- 3BM8n7e5z9SgFkcN5HcWbFE2TPU7ztHPqr